4 PM

Orienteering 33:41 [2] 4.95 km (6:48 / km) +68m 6:22 / km

QOC's Squirrel Kill event hosted by Ted Good. He organized a mini sprint training camp. First, we did a few drills: finding the start triangle quickly; being smooth through the controls, etc.

Then we did a memory score-O. The map had 20 controls, and you had 35 minutes to get them all, remembering symbols that were drawn on the flags. I made three trips out, thinking that 7 was the maximum number of objects I could hold in my brain. The first loop was easy, as all the controls were in the parking lots and fields around the high school where we started. The second loop, however, was in the forest, and I got lost almost immediately. Was able to recover after a while and picked up seven more controls, but wasted too much time. I only had time for five more on the final loop, so I left out one control. Joe Barrett managed to get all 20.
5 PM

Orienteering 18:41 [4] 3.41 km (5:29 / km) +27m 5:16 / km

The next exercise was a regular sprint course, but with the caveat that you could only look at the map once per leg. This went ok, with the exception that I got trapped by a fence on the way to the last control and had to take an extra look in addition to losing a minute or so.
6 PM

Orienteering 23:00 [3] 4.7 km (4:53 / km)
shoes: Blue/Orange Asics 2019

The final session was a long sprint in an industrial park that Ted Good has mapped. It was fairly straightforward, with a lot of pavement running, which my legs did not like. Still, the course was enjoyable, and it was good to practice flow with an actual sprint map.

Fun and games and pizza at the Good house afterwards. Very enjoyable.

Saturday Aug 17, 2019 #

8 AM

Orienteering 3:44:04 [3] 20.24 km (11:04 / km) +960m 8:57 / km
shoes: Old VJ Falcons From Online Auc

For this week's QOC Summer Short Series, Michael Dickey organized a full-blown 6-hour Rogaine at Sugarloaf, complete with a brand new map that he made over the last year. I'd hiked at Sugarloaf a few times before and was excited to get out into the terrain.

I wasn't sure how my tweaked glute would respond, so had no real ambitions, but it mostly felt ok, especially off-trail, so after a few minutes I decided to go for clearing the course. I orienteered well, with the exception of a massive goof at control 34, which was right on the edge of one of the map sheets. Had I looked on the other side of the map, I would have seen a large set of cliffs next to the ones that the control was on, but instead I spent like ten minutes searching in the wrong cliffs. I gave up and started heading to my next control, but then stopped to flip the map just in case, and saw my mistake. Even after getting back, I lost time because of a confusing control description. All in all, close to 20 minutes gone!

Besides that, it was smooth sailing navigationally. All the controls where were I expected them, and the woods were fairly nice, though rocky, for the most part. I ran the flats, downhills, and gradual uphills for the first 2.5 hours or so, and mostly walked after that. With three controls to go, my calves started getting those twinges of cramps on the uphills, but I stretched a bit, and those feelings went away.

To help improve the relationship with this park, Michael offered bonus points for bringing trash out of the woods, so I picked up a couple of empty beer cans that I came across. Great idea!

Nutrition: two GUs, one one packet of energy beans, one granola bar, 1.5 liters of water.

Route (planned to reduce climb in favor of potential extra distance): S-53-51-52-47-45-43-44-40-38-33-31-34-32-35-36-39-37-41-48-50-55-54-49-46-42-F.
